New Orleans Saints 14 @ Houston Texans 27: Sloppy Saints

HOUSTON - AUGUST 20: Running back Darren Sproles #43 of the New Orleans Saints is forced out of bounds by linebacker Xavier Adibi #52 of the Houston Texans at Reliant Stadium on August 20, 2011 in Houston, Texas. (Photo by Bob Levey/Getty Images)

Well, that was ugly. The Saints played incredibly sloppy as they fell to the Houston Texans 27-14. Most notably, the defense sucked a big one. That's what you really need to take away from this game.
